    Geico Customers Win Class Cert. In NJ Underpayment Suit

    A New Jersey federal judge has certified a class of Geico policyholders in the state over claims that the insurance giant undervalued their total loss claims by not including taxes and fees and by applying so-called condition adjustments to the values of comparable vehicles without explaining the rationale behind them.
